Curry Early Childhood Center
The Curry Early Childhood Center is an integral part of the Curry College Community. The Center provides a warm and nurturing educational experience for infants, toddlers, and preschool children. The Center also offers Curry College students an opportunity for authentic and integrative learning experiences. We reflect the mission of the College to value individual differences while promoting students' cognitive, social, physical and emotional development.
We strive to create the foundation for lifelong learning in children and adults as they become critical thinkers, effective communicators, creative and productive learners, and socially responsible, engaged citizens in our multicultural society. We will accomplish this by:
- Being a model program of high quality education and care for young children
- Using best practice in child development to foster the growth and learning of each child
- Creating a challenging yet nurturing educational environment for students and staff
- Providing highly trained mentors and supervisors who support college student learning
- Establishing creative educational partnerships with faculty and college departments, including Education, Nursing and Psychology
- Fostering adult learning experiences through observation, practica, internships and employment
- Building positive relationships with and support for families
The philosophy of the Curry Early Childhood Center is to provide a safe, nurturing, and cheerful educational setting where learning takes place everywhere and at all times. The curriculum is based on a child's natural curiosity and desire to learn; through play, practicing skills, and experimenting with materials, children learn about themselves and the world around them. We strive to foster individuality, creativity, and independence and create an environment where children feel free to explore and express themselves. The uniqueness of each family's composition and cultural traditions is valued as we strive to develop a relationship with each family where staff and parents work together to support the development of each child.
